Twain-Tech

Overview

Alias

 Adware/MultiMPP [Panda], Adware/Twain-Tech [Panda], Spyware/BetterInet [Panda], Trojan.Win32.Keyhost.e (Kaspersky AV), Adware-Searchcentrix [McAfee], Twain-Tech adware, Win32/Spy.BiSpy.C trojan [Eset],

Category

 Adware: Software that displays popup/popunder ads when the primary user interface is not visible or which do not appear to be assocaited with the product.

Browser Helper Object:  (BHO). A component that Internet Explorer will load whenever it starts, shares IE's memory context, can perform any action on the available windows and modules. A BHO can detect events, create windows to display additional information on a viewed page, monitor messages and actions. Microsoft calls it "a spy we send to infiltrate the browser's land." BHOs are not stopped by personal firewalls, because they are seen by the firewall as your browser itself. Some exploits of this technology search all pages you view in IE and replace banner advertisements with other ads. Some monitor and report on your actions. Some change your home page.

Detection and Removal

Manual Removal

 If you want to uninstall, you can do so easily through the add/remove function in your control panel. You can access your control panel by going to:
  • 1. Start (typically, the button in the bottom left of your screen)
  • 2. Choose SETTINGS
  • 3. Choose CONTROL PANEL
  • 4. Choose ADD/REMOVE PROGRAMS
  • 5. Select twain-tech
  • 6. Click on ADD/REMOVE

    In the absence of an entry in ADD/REMOVE PROGRAMS please use on of the following methods:

    For Windows98 and WindowsXP users:

  • a) To permanently disable the software click "Start" and then "Run" and type the following command which unregisters the software: regsvr32 c:\windows\twaintec.dll "
  • b) To completely remove the software: reboot and then Find and Delete the file mxtarget.dll. For Windows2000, WindowsME and WindowsNT users:
  • a) To permanently disable the software click "Start" and then "Run" and type the following command which unregisters the software: "regsvr32 c:\winnt\twaintec.dll "
  • b) To completely remove the software: reboot and then Find and Delete the file twaintec.dll.

  •  Stop Running Processes:

    Kill these running processes with Task Manager:



    Remove Autorun Reference:

    Go To the key H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run


    If you find the value H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\software\microsoft\windows\currentversion\run\oyyilj8kl, delete it and reboot the machine immediately.

    If you find the value H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\software\microsoft\windows\currentversion\run\xgn, delete it and reboot the machine immediately.
